Springfield IL electrical permit rules

Springfield's building inspections requires electrical permits for circuit additions, panel upgrades, service capacity changes, and new wiring. Apply via springfield.il.us. Illinois licensed electricians must perform permitted work. Illinois contractor licensing for general contractors. Call (217) 789-2171 with scope questions.

Springfield is the state capital of Illinois and home to Abraham Lincoln's pre-presidential home, now a national historic site. The city is served for electricity by CWLP — City Water, Light & Power — a municipal electric utility operated by the City of Springfield itself. This makes Springfield similar to Burlington VT (Burlington Electric) in having a city-owned electric utility rather than an investor-owned company. CWLP handles electric, water, and sanitary sewer for the city. Natural gas is served separately by Nicor Gas. Illinois contractor licensing applies.

City Water, Light & Power (CWLP) — Springfield's MUNICIPAL electric utility serves Springfield for electricity ((217) 789-2120 / cwlp.com). For service-entrance work, panel upgrades, or solar interconnection, contact City Water, Light & Power (CWLP) in parallel with the city permit — utility scheduling adds 2–5 weeks. Nicor Gas (1-888-642-6748) serves natural gas separately.

Three Springfield electrical scenarios

Scenario A
200A panel upgrade — City Water, Light & Power (CWLP) coordination
Electrical permit via springfield.il.us. IL licensed electrician. City Water, Light & Power (CWLP) ((217) 789-2120) for service entrance — start same day as city permit.
Electrical permit | Licensed electrician | Utility same-day | ~$2,500–$6,000
Scenario B
EV charger installation
240V/50A circuit. Electrical permit. IL licensed electrician. Panel capacity check. City Water, Light & Power (CWLP) time-of-use rate for overnight charging.
Electrical permit | Licensed electrician | Panel check | ~$700–$1,800
Scenario C
New circuits for renovation
Electrical permit via springfield.il.us. IL licensed electrician. Coordinate with building and plumbing permits.
Electrical permit | Licensed electrician | ~$200–$600 per circuit
